Hadith 6292

وَعَنْهُ أَيْضًا أَنَّ رَسُولَ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َآلِهِ وَسَلَّمَ قَالَ الْعَائِدُ فِي هِبَتِهِ كَالْعَائِدِ فِي قَيْئِهِ قَالَ قَتَادَةُ وَلَا أَعْلَمُ الْقَيْئَ إِلَّا حَرَامًا
Narrated by Sayyiduna Abdullah bin Abbas (may Allah be pleased with them both) that the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ings be upon him) said: The one who takes back a gift is like a person who starts licking his own vomit. Imam Qatadah said: In my opinion, vomit is forbidden.

Brief Explanation
Benefits: … There is no such evidence that indicates the prohibition or impurity of vomit; in reality, the matter is being stated by observing the disposition of a person of sound nature. It is correct that there is no evidence for the prohibition or impurity of vomit, but to take back a gift after giving it is prohibited, as is made clear from Hadith 6290.
